Not all nature photography needs to be done in such remote locations. This is probably the most photographed tree in the Japanese Garden in downtown Portland, OR. But that didn't stop me from having a crack at it.


Normally, I prefer to photograph natural features like trees under diffuse light, such as what you'd find on an overcast day, or during the very early or very late hours of the day. But in this scenario, I was able to photograph under full midday sun, which was diffused by the canopy of the tree itself. You might say the hard overhead light enhanced the moment by creating interesting shadows on the grass underneath the branches.
